Missy - i usually hand soak in napisan and then wash normally. Also apprently hanging it on the line outside the sun makes the stains dissapear, haven't tested myself as live in a flat.0 -
Missy- Ahh ok the only other thing i can think of is cycling your LO's legs around to try help the wind out.
Fairy is rubbish with stains isnt it! I have to use it on my clothes also as im allergic to all other washing powders. I normally get an actual bar of soap and scrub the stain with it and then put in the washing machine as normal.
